In most cases the issue you are facing happens when a screen protector is interferring with the ear proximity sensor, which detects when you have your phone up to your face and turns the screen off.&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;P&gt;Remove the screen protector and run the test he mentioned (&lt;SPAN&gt;settings &amp;gt; about phone &amp;gt; diagnostics &amp;gt; test &amp;gt; test proximity sensor) and see if it vibrates immediately, or only when you cover the phone.&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;</description>
